进阶学习:如何查看Linux线程栈(查看linux线程栈)
信息
进阶学习–如何查看Linux线程栈信息
在学习Linux操作系统的过程中,我们会接触到一个概念–线程栈,它可以帮助我们更加深入地了解复杂的Linux系统机制。而学习如何查看Linux线程栈信息也是核心技能之一。下面我们将一步步来学习如何查看Linux线程栈信息。
首先,我们需要使用`ps`命令来查看当前运行的线程,并且用`grep`筛选特定线程:
ps -T | grep
然后,使用tracer`PID`显示线程栈的内容:
strace -T -f -p
接着,我们可以使用`pstack`来跟踪崩溃点:
pstack
最后,使用`gdb`来查看线程栈:
gdb -p
@ (gdb) thread apply all bt
以上就是查看Linux线程栈信息的几种方法,我们要熟记在心,以便在实际工作或学习中迅速查看线程栈信息。同时也要加强对Linux系统的学习,以提高解决Linux高级问题的能力。